Web15 Nov 2024 · Sea star wasting syndrome is a devastating disease that affects at least 20 different species of sea stars. Characterized by white lesions, twisted or missing arms, deflation, and eventual disintegration, SSWS causes a gruesome and gooey death for sea stars. Web16 hours ago · The pub has survived "residents' revolts, collapsing ceilings, flooding toilets and of course Covid" bristolpost Load mobile navigation. ... with the Merchants Arms in … WebIn April 2014, Oregon began to experience a massive die-off of sea stars (Pisaster ochraceus) in near-shore environments. The cause of the depletion was named Sea Star Wasting Disease. This affliction was characterized by twisting arms, then deflation and/or lesions, lost arms, losing grip on substrate, and finally disintegration. A proximate ...
